An intermediate-level prompt might begin with an open-ended question designed to provoke thought without overwhelming participants. For instance, consider the prompt: "Imagine a future where AI curates personalized shopping experiences for every customer in real-time. Discuss potential benefits and drawbacks for retailers and consumers." This prompt is beneficial as it encourages exploration of both positive and negative aspects, stimulating a balanced discussion. However, it could be critiqued for its lack of specificity and context, which might lead to vague or unfocused contributions. To enhance this, one could refine the prompt to include more detailed scenarios or guidelines, potentially narrowing the focus to specific retail sectors or consumer demographics.
A more advanced prompt might build on the previous example by incorporating additional layers of complexity and context. For instance: "Considering the recent advancements in AI-driven personalization, how can online fashion retailers leverage machine learning algorithms to improve customer retention and reduce return rates? Evaluate the ethical implications and potential challenges involved." This improved prompt demonstrates a strategic enhancement in its structure, as it introduces a specific application within the retail industry and asks participants to critically evaluate both opportunities and potential pitfalls. The specificity encourages targeted thinking and facilitates deeper discussion about measurable outcomes and ethical considerations.
Moving to an expert-level prompt, the refinement process can incorporate even greater contextual awareness and a direct link to strategic business outcomes. Consider the evolution to: "In the context of increasing consumer demand for sustainable practices, how can AI-driven product recommendations in the e-commerce fashion industry be optimized to promote eco-friendly choices without compromising revenue growth? Propose innovative solutions, considering both technological and market-driven factors." This prompt not only narrows the focus to a specific, pressing issue in the industry but also requires participants to propose solutions that balance sustainability with profitability. By doing so, it challenges participants to think critically about the intersection of technology, market trends, and ethical considerations, fostering a comprehensive and strategic approach to ideation.
The progression from intermediate to expert-level prompts illustrates the underlying principles that drive these improvements. A key principle is the alignment of prompts with specific business objectives and industry contexts, ensuring that discussions remain relevant and outcome-oriented. The incorporation of ethical considerations and potential challenges encourages a balanced evaluation of ideas, fostering a critical mindset. Furthermore, the emphasis on specificity and context enhances the ability of participants to generate actionable insights, improving the overall quality of the brainstorming output. By systematically refining prompts to address these principles, organizations can harness the full potential of AI in their ideation processes, driving innovation and competitive advantage.
